Angkor Eye Playground
Angkor Eye Playground is one of those easy, reliable play stops in Siem Reap that works brilliantly with kids.
Located next to the Angkor Eye, this is a large, covered outdoor playground, which instantly makes it more practical in the heat. The roof provides great shade, so even on warmer days it feels manageable — something that makes a huge difference with kids.
The playground itself is colourful and spacious, with multiple slides, climbing sections, tunnels, and platforms to explore. It’s big enough that kids can move around freely and find different routes to climb and slide, which keeps them entertained for a good stretch of time. Ours were straight into it the moment they saw it.
Entry is $1 per child, which feels very reasonable for the amount of play time you get.
If you’re in Siem Reap and want a shaded, outdoor playground where kids can properly climb and slide without overheating — and without spending much — Angkor Eye Playground is a really solid option to have saved.
